TI Released 26-Watt PoE Controller

Posted in Brief News
On Saturday, September 23, 2006

Texas Instruments Incorporated introduced a 26-watt Power
over Ethernet (PoE) controller that allows Ethernet-powered devices, such as IP cameras, WiMAX access points and IP phones, to use twice as much power from a standard Ethernet cable without the need of an AC line.
